Leptopterna is a genus of plant bugs in the Miridae family.[2][3][4]

List of species
- Leptopterna albescens (Reuter, 1891)
- Leptopterna amoena Uhler, 1872[5]
- Leptopterna dentifera Linnavuori, 1970
- Leptopterna dolabrata (Linnaeus, 1758)
- Leptopterna emeljanovi Vinokurov, 1982
- Leptopterna euxina Vinokurov, 1982
- Leptopterna ferrugata (Fallén, 1807)[5]
- Leptopterna griesheimae Wagner, 1952
- Leptopterna pilosa Reuter, 1880
Former species
- Leptopterna silacea Bliven 1973 junior synonym of Leptopterna amoena Uhler, 1872[5]
